Please and thank you :( (I have a deadline today in 3 hours) A Web music store offers two versions of a popular song. The size of the standard version is 2.3 megabytes (MB). The size of the high-quality version is 4.7 MB. Yesterday, there were 1120 downloads of the song, for a total download size of 3128 MB. How many downloads of the standard version were there?
